Why Clear Plastic Gloves Are Essential in Emergency First Aid

When emergencies strike β€” whether on the roadside, in a disaster zone, or within a clinical setting β€” the ability to act swiftly while maintaining contamination control is paramount. Clear plastic gloves, including disposable nitrile and vinyl variants, have become a cornerstone of emergency first aid kits and response protocols globally.

Their transparency allows responders to visually monitor hand condition, detect contamination immediately, and maintain fine motor control during critical procedures such as wound dressing, IV insertion, and triage. Unlike opaque alternatives, clear gloves provide instant visual feedback β€” a small feature with potentially life-saving consequences.

🧀 Key Insight: In mass casualty incidents, responders change gloves up to 30 times per hour. Clear disposable gloves reduce cross-contamination risk while enabling rapid, confident action.

The global emergency medical services (EMS) market increasingly specifies clear or translucent disposable gloves as part of standardized PPE protocols, recognizing their dual benefit of protection and visual clarity in high-pressure scenarios.

Market Overview & Industry Trends

The clear plastic glove market for emergency and medical use is undergoing rapid transformation driven by global health awareness, regulatory evolution, and technological innovation.

πŸ“ˆ Explosive Market Growth

The global disposable gloves market was valued at over USD 14 billion in 2023 and is projected to exceed USD 28 billion by 2030, growing at a CAGR of approximately 10.5%. Emergency medical services, disaster response organizations, and public health agencies are the primary growth drivers. Post-pandemic preparedness policies have led governments worldwide to mandate strategic stockpiling of clear disposable gloves as part of national emergency reserves.

🏭 China's Manufacturing Leadership

China remains the world's dominant supplier of clear plastic disposable gloves, accounting for over 40% of global production capacity. Advanced manufacturing hubs in Jiangsu, Guangdong, and Shandong provinces operate highly automated production lines capable of producing billions of units annually. Chinese manufacturers have significantly upgraded quality standards to meet FDA, CE, and ISO 13485 certification requirements demanded by international emergency response agencies.

🌱 Eco-Innovation & Biodegradable Materials

Environmental concerns are reshaping the clear glove industry. Leading manufacturers are investing in bio-based vinyl compounds, reduced-thickness formulations that maintain protective performance while cutting material usage by up to 20%, and recyclable packaging systems. Some innovators are pioneering compostable clear glove variants specifically designed for lower-risk emergency scenarios where full nitrile-grade protection is not required.

πŸ€– Smart Manufacturing & AI Quality Control

Industry 4.0 technologies are being integrated into glove production for emergency supply chains. AI-powered visual inspection systems now detect micro-perforations and thickness inconsistencies in real time at production speeds exceeding 200 gloves per minute. Blockchain-based supply chain traceability ensures that every batch of emergency-use clear gloves can be traced from raw material sourcing to final delivery, meeting the strict audit requirements of government procurement agencies.

Deep-Dive Application Scenarios

Clear plastic gloves serve as the critical interface between responder and patient across a wide spectrum of emergency and industrial environments.

Emergency Medical First Aid Response

πŸš‘ Emergency Medical & First Aid Response

Paramedics, EMTs, and trauma nurses rely on clear nitrile gloves for triage, wound management, and patient transport. Their transparency enables instant contamination detection during high-volume patient throughput in mass casualty incidents, pandemic response, and disaster relief operations.

Emergency Food Safety and Disaster Relief

🍽️ Disaster Relief Food Distribution

In natural disaster scenarios, emergency food distribution teams use food-grade clear vinyl gloves to maintain hygiene standards while serving affected populations. Clear gloves allow supervisors to quickly verify proper glove usage and identify contamination risks in high-throughput relief operations.

Industrial Emergency Response and Hazmat

βš™οΈ Industrial Hazmat & Emergency Response

Chemical plant emergency response teams, hazmat units, and industrial first responders deploy clear nitrile gloves as the inner layer of multi-layer PPE systems. Their chemical resistance and transparency support rapid assessment and re-gloving protocols during chemical spill response and industrial accident management.
